An isosceles trapezoid has vertices at (-2, 1), (2, 1), (5, -1) and (-5, -1). find the measure of each diagonal

well, is an isosceles trapezoid, namely the slanted sides are equal, so the diagonals, in red, are also equal, so let's just find the length of the solid line diagona, since the dashed one will be the same length anyway.


~~~~~~~~~~~~\textit{distance between 2 points} \\\\ (\stackrel{x_1}{-5}~,~\stackrel{y_1}{-1})\qquad (\stackrel{x_2}{2}~,~\stackrel{y_2}{1})\qquad \qquad d = √(( x_2- x_1)^2 + ( y_2- y_1)^2) \\\\\\ d=√([2 - (-5)]^2 + [1 - (-1)]^2)\implies d=√((2+5)^2+(1+1)^2) \\\\\\ d=√(7^2+2^2)\implies d=√(53)\implies d\approx 7.28
